Silva - Binoculars Pocket 10X

Reading a distant shoreline, identifying a navigation marker across open water, or picking out a campsite on a far hillside all get easier with a bit more magnification, and the Silva Pocket 10x delivers that extra reach without adding bulk to your kit.

Stepping up from the 8x model, the 10x magnification brings distant subjects noticeably closer, which pays off when you're scanning for channels through a rocky archipelago from a kayak cockpit or checking terrain detail on a route you're considering from a ridgeline. The trade-off for higher magnification is a slightly tighter field of view at 96 metres, so it rewards a steadier hand and rewards deliberate glassing rather than quick scanning. Still pocketable, still light enough to forget it's in your pack until you need it.

Durable enough to handle the moisture, bumps, and general roughness of Canadian outdoor travel, these binoculars fit naturally alongside your compass and map as everyday navigation kit. Compact binoculars are one of those items paddlers and hikers consistently wish they had brought more often than they regret carrying.

  • Magnification: 10x
  • Field of view: 96 m
  • Compact and pocketable form factor
  • Lightweight construction
  • Durable build for outdoor use
  • Suitable for kayaking, hiking, camping, and wildlife observation
  • Includes carrying case
